Description
This position will serve as the Assistant Men’s and Women’s Track & Field / Cross Country Coach. The Assistant Coach adheres to departmental policies and procedures, as well as rules and regulations of the University, the ACC and the NCAA. In addition, this position will assist with scouting and recruiting, to include on campus visits of prospective student-athletes.
Key Responsibilities:
- Adheres to the NCAA and ACC governing policies and procedures. Attend compliance education meetings; demonstrating commitment to both the intent and spirit of applicable NCAA and ACC rules and regulations; demonstrating integrity and professionalism in applying guidelines to individual program.
- Assists with the scouting and recruitment of student-athletes, to include assisting with on-campus visits of prospective student-athletes.
- Assists in coaching and teaching skill-development in student-athletes. Instructs on team philosophy, physical health and safety.
- Monitors the conditioning and training of student-athletes, in conjunction with the Strength Coach and the Athletic Training staff.
- Attends coaches’ preparatory meetings. Assists in developing and implementing strategies resulting from these meetings.
- Advises and counsels with student-athletes regarding their obligations to comply with all rules and regulations related to financial aid and eligibility, academic performance, as well as personal conduct and appearance.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ree Required.
- Minimum of 1 year prior experience working with collegiate Track & Field/Cross Country program.
